WINONA, Minn. — The Saint Mary's University of Minnesota women's hockey team steps out of conference play on Saturday, as the Cardinals entertain St. Norbert in a 4 p.m. nonconference game at the Saint Mary's Ice Arena.
The Matchup:• Saint Mary's Cardinals (3-2-1 Overall) vs. St. Norbert Green Knights (2-4-0 Overall)

Saint Mary's vs. St. Norbert—A Year Ago:• November 29, 2014 * De Pere, Wis.: For the first 40 minutes, Saint Mary's and St. Norbert saw themselves embroiled in a defensive battle. After scoring just one goal—combined—through two periods, the teams combined for six goals over the final 20 minutes. Unfortunately for the Cardinals, it was St. Norbert's offense that did the majority of the damage, scoring four third-period goals in handing Saint Mary's a 5-2 setback at Resch Olympic Pavilion | Recap
Up Next:• Saint Mary's: The Cardinals are back on their home ice for a pair of Minnesota Intercollegiate Athletic Conference games against Concordia next weekend. Saint Mary's and the Cobbers will square off at 7 p.m. on Friday and 2 p.m. on Saturday at the Saint Mary's Ice Arena.
• St. Norbert: The Green Knights return to NCHA action next weekend, traveling to Mequon, Wis., for a pair of games against Concordia (Wis.).

2015-16 Schedule• With their 2-1, 3-1 sweep of St. Olaf last weekend, the Cardinals improved to 2-0-1 in their last three games. … Saint Mary's has allowed just one goal in each of its last three games—including its 2-1 and 3-1 wins over St. Olaf last weekend. … The Cardinals' 1-1 tie against Bethel on Nov. 13 snapped their two-game losing streak. … The Cardinals' 2-1 and 3-1 wins over St. Olaf last weekend marked the fourth and fifth straight games—and the 16 and 17th times in their last 18 contests—that the game has been decided by two goals or less. … Last Saturday's 1-1 tie vs. Bethel was the Cardinals' first overtime game of the season. Saint Mary's played six OT games a year ago, going 2-1-3. … The Cardinals' five-goal effort against UW-Superior in their 5-2 season-opening win on Oct. 30 was the Cardinals' highest offensive output since netting five goals in a 5-3 win over Hamline on Feb. 23, 2014. …
Jamie Henderson (Madison, Wis.) and
McKenna Parent (Anoka, Minn.) accounted for all five of the Cardinals' goals last weekend against St. Olaf. The duo each scored in Saint Mary's 2-1 win in Game 1, while Henderson added a pair of goals and Parent netted the other in the Cardinals' 3-1 Game 2 win. … Henderson and Parent each finished with four points vs. the Oles last weekend—Henderson scored three goals and added an assist, while Parent had two goals and two helpers. … Henderson has now posted two two-goal games in her collegiate career—the sophomore also scored twice in Saint Mary's 4-1 win over UW-Eau Claire on Jan. 2, 2015. … With her goals last weekend, Parent enters Saturday's game against St. Norbert having scored in three straight contests. …
Macki Fadness (Eau Claire, Wis.) recorded three assists vs. the Oles—including two in the Cardinals' 2-1 win—while
Kassie Lien (Grantsburg, Wis.) assisted on two of Saint Mary's three goals in its 3-1 win. … Fadness equaled her career high with her two-assist night vs. the Oles, while Lien notched her first collegiate two-assist performance. … Henderson is now the team's goal-scoring leader with four, while Parent boasts team-highs in assists (4) and points (7). …
Tori Herrmann (Elk River, Minn.) finished with 33 saves in goal for the Cardinals against St. Olaf last Friday, while
Marah Shields (Milford, Mich.) stopped 26 of the 27 shots she faced in the teams' rematch on Saturday. … Herrmann has now made three starts, going 2-0-1 with a 1.30 goals-against-average and .961 save percentage, with Shields close behind with a 2.01 GAA and .955 save percentage. … Shields recorded a school-record 79 saves in the Cardinals' 2-0 loss to UW-Superior on Oct. 31. … The 79-save effort—which ranks No. 6 all-time in NCAA Division III history—is 24 saves more than the previous record of 55, set by Nikki Jung against Gustavus on Jan. 21, 2005. … Shields made 22 saves in the first period, 33 in the second, and 24 in the third en route to her 79-save performance. … The Cardinals have outscored their opponents 13-11 through six games—including 6-5 in the second period and 4-3 in the third. … The Cardinals have scored first in all three of their wins this season (3-0-0). Saint Mary's is 0-2-1 when its opponent nets the game's first goal. … Saint Mary's is coming off an 11-win season a year ago—the Cardinals' highest win total since going 11-11-3 during the 2010-11 season. … With their 5-2 win over UW-Superior on Oct. 30, the Cardinals snapped a four-game season-opening winless streak (0-3-1). Saint Mary's last season-opening win was a 5-0 victory over Marian on Oct. 29, 2010.

2015-16 Schedule• Saturday's game at Saint Mary's is the second of eight straight road games for the Green Knights, who do not return home until Jan. 16 against UW-Stevens Point. … With their win against Finlandia last Tuesday, St. Norbert has now won two of its last three contests—both by shutout. … The Green Knights have outscored their opponents 7-1 in their three wins, but they have been outscored 18-10 in their four losses. … St. Norbert has surrendered four or more goals in each of its four losses—including a season-high five in 5-4 and 5-3 losses to St. Scholastica. … Rebecka Olson and Kyle Gazzolo scored the Green Knights' two goals against Finlandia last Tuesday. … Olson's goal vs. the Lions was the first of her collegiate career. … Brianna Kelly stopped all 11 Finlandia shots for her first shutout of the season. … Reaghan Chadwick enters Saturday's game at Saint Mary's as the team-leader in both assists (4) and points (8). … Chadwick shares the team's goal-scoring lead (4) with Lauren Roethlisberger. … St. Norbert's 17 goals this season have come from nine different players, while 17 Green Knights have recorded at least one point. … Kelly and Leigh Grall have shared the goaltending duties this season. Kelly owns a team-leading 2.20 goals-against-average and an .882 save percentage in four games, while Grall has also made four appearances, posting a 3.04 GAA and .872 save percentage. … Grall recorded her first shutout of the season with 13 saves against Marian on Nov. 17. … St. Norbert holds a 5-4 scoring edge in the game's third period—the Green Knights have been outscored 6-4 in the first and 9-8 in the second. … St. Norbert has scored the game's first goal in four of its seven games, going 3-1-0. The Green Knights are still looking for their first win (0-3-0) when their opponent scores first.
